From c31a96d4cb8050c1c3614e834cc33a7fb2dbd32c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Artem Bilan Date: Thu, 6 Oct 2016 17:13:29 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] INT-4132: Start MS Before Scheduling Polling Task JIRA: https://jira.spring.io/browse/INT-4132 The race condition is present when polling task may be ran before `MessageSource` has been started. * Swap the order of `start()` in the `SourcePollingChannelAdapter`. Since proxying is now applied only for the `MessageSource.receive()` it doesn't hurt to start it before actual proxying. Just because it is really should be started before performing its `receive()` * Prove the proper order with the mock test and protect ourselves for the future similar changes * Also swap the `stop()` order in the `SourcePollingChannelAdapter. We have to stop/cancel the polling task before discarding internal `MessageSource` lifecycle. For example with the current state we may close an underlying resource already, but still have the last polling tick.
